Fuji Card Payment Review @UXLINKofficial
1/ Today, I went to GS25 for the first time and made a payment using Apple Pay with my Fuji card. The price was 2200 won, which amounted to $1.68.
2/ Based on the current exchange rate, it's 2286 won. It seems like the 86 won can be considered a fee. Is it about 4%? That could be quite significant..?
3/ The payment details can be checked right after the transaction, and you can see where you made the payment as well. But GS25 got translated to Jieshu25, lol.
4/ Also, if you go to the UXLINK airdrop Season 4 page, you can see how much you charged and how much you paid. I will be using this to buy delicious food diligently!
